Form 4: Phinia Inc. Director Brady D. Ericson Reports Acquisition of Common Stock

Sentiment:

SEC Form 4 Filing


Brady D. Ericson, a director and President and CEO of Phinia Inc., reported the acquisition of 1,894 shares of common stock through dividend reinvestment.

Summary

  • On September 13, 2024, Brady D. Ericson, a director and the President and CEO of Phinia Inc., acquired 1,894 shares of common stock.
  • The acquisition was a result of the automatic reinvestment of dividends on outstanding restricted stock and restricted stock units.
  • The price per share was $0.
  • Following the transaction, Ericson beneficially owns 437,800 shares of Phinia Inc.
  • This total includes 238,628 shares of restricted stock and 110,876 restricted stock units.
